stepper motor assembly

When the ignition is turned off, the plunger is motored all the way, it's the clicking you can hear if you listen closely. It gives the ECU a datum to work from because it has no feedback loop as to the actual position of the plunger.
Of course, if it is in the wrong position it would have the wrong air mix, so if you turn the ignition on and off again, it should then be in the correct place.
